    HELP: fogging up ZKW headlights

    I put some angel eyes into my zkw's and now one of them is fogging up when the weather gets cold/rainy. I put some silicone on the lens in each headlight before closing it back up but for some reason the passenger side headlight fogs.

    How can I solve this problem and why did it fog in the first place?

    I was under the impression that you dont even need that much silicone to seal up the lights after you take them out to put in angel eyes. So why is mine fogging up?

    This morning I used a heat gun and held it to the glass to try and defog the lens but I ended up melting some of the paint off my eyelids instead
